2815-01-286-5067 is a Internal Combustion Engine Piston that does not have a nuclear hardened feature or any other critical feature such as tolerance, fit restriction or application. This item is considered a low risk when released from the control of the Department of Defense. The item may still be subject to the requirements of the Export Administration Regulations (EAR) and the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R). This item is not suspected to be hazardous. This item does not contain a precious metal.

2815-01-286-5067 has freight characteristics managed by the Food and Drug Administration (FDA).It has a National Motor Freight Classification (NMFC) of 126560. A Sub NMFC of X. It has a NMFC Description of PILE DRIVERS/EXTRACTORS/PULLERS ETC. 2815-01-286-5067 is rated as class 65 when transported by Less-Than Truckload (LTL) freight. 2815-01-286-5067 is rated as class 65 when transported by Less-Than Carload (LCL) rail or ocean freight. It has a Uniform Freight Classification (UFC) number of 64190 which rates the freight between FCL and LCL. 2815-01-286-5067 has a variance between NMFC and UFC when transported by rail and the description should be consulted. It has a Water Commodity Code (WCC) of 593 for ocean manifesting and military sealift. 2815-01-286-5067 is not classified as a special type of cargo when transported by water. 2815-01-286-5067 is not a consolidation and does not exceed 84" in any dimension. It should be compatible with a standard 72" Aircraft Cargo Door when transported by air.
